Fund Overview
VAB is a broad Canadian fixed-income index fund managed by Vanguard Investments Canada, holding a diversified mix of Canadian government and investment-grade corporate bonds rather than equities.
Index Strategy
VAB tracks the Bloomberg Global Aggregate Canadian Float Adjusted Bond Index, a market-capitalization-weighted index of Canadian federal, provincial, and investment-grade corporate bonds across a range of maturities. Index membership and weights are set by Bloomberg Index Services, an independent third-party index provider.
Geographic Exposure
All underlying holdings are Canadian-dollar-denominated bonds issued by Canadian governments and corporations; the fund does not hold foreign-currency-denominated bonds.
Principal Risks
As a fund tracking a broad investment-grade Canadian bond index, VAB.TO carries interest-rate risk (bond prices generally fall when interest rates rise) and credit risk from its corporate and government bond holdings, along with general fixed-income market risk; it does not carry equity-market risk.
